Transaction ac3399ce76dbe50c90fc4abb941c801242e09f851ab14a76a8cc357f67dd8fc7
1 Input
1 Output
-
ac3399ce76dbe50c90fc4abb941c801242e09f851ab14a76a8cc357f67dd8fc7:0
- value
- 81670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eda35a532468c7c76ff8fc4055896ed612ab2260 OP_EQUAL
- address
- 3PMXkxhtzJ3wJABhcozwkzf2SYVDX6b3SF